Hazard Vulnerability Analysis For Healthcare Facilities Market

A Hazard Vulnerability Analysis (HVA) is performed on a healthcare facility to identify and prioritize all risks that could compromise patient care. To safeguard the safety of patients, staff, and visitors in the case of an emergency or disaster, it is necessary to conduct an HVA and establish an effective emergency planning and response strategy. Healthcare facilities are realizing the importance of thorough hazard vulnerability analysis in light of the growing frequency and intensity of storms, among other natural disasters, earthquakes, floods, and wildfires.

Healthcare institutions must undertake comprehensive hazard vulnerability analysis to ensure compliance with government and healthcare regulatory organizations' stringent regulatory rules and requirements to maintain accreditation. As healthcare institutions seek comprehensive tools to manage a variety of hazards effectively, there has been a rise in the demand for integrated healthcare risk management solutions that incorporate hazard vulnerability analysis as a core component. For smaller healthcare facilities with limited funds, comprehensive hazard risk analysis might be difficult to perform due to expensive upfront costs, including cutting-edge equipment, staff training, and infrastructure changes. Healthcare facilities may struggle to implement and maintain comprehensive risk assessment and mitigation programs due to a lack of qualified hazard vulnerability assessors and risk management experts. Recent infectious disease outbreaks and global public health events like the COVID-19 pandemic have shown hospitals the importance of hazard vulnerability analysis for effective response and containment.
